F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E New Book About Poltergeists, Ghosts, and Demons Released Ingleside, IL August 15, 2013 The Geek s Guide to the Strange & Unusual: Poltergeists, Ghosts, and Demons, a 168-page book by paranormal investigator Rick E. Hale, is now available on Amazon, CreateSpace, and various ebook platforms. The Geek s Guide explores many of the most intriguing paranormal cases and haunted locations around the world, including the Demon Drummer of Tedworth, Lucedio Abbey, the Dagg Poltergeist, and three cases of possession. When I set out to write this book, I wanted it to be educational and entertaining, Rick explained. My favorite case included within the book s pages would have to be 50 Berkley Square in London, England. Ever since I was a kid, this legend of a spirit that has the ability to drive witnesses mad, as well as having a body count, has fascinated me. If I should ever make it across the pond, I am determined to spend the night in that building! The Geek s Guide to the Strange & Unusual: Poltergeists, Ghosts, and Demons is a book written for those who have a sense of adventure and are looking for answers to some of the greatest mysteries confronting mankind. About the Author Rick Hale has spent his life in the pursuit of the unknown after witnessing an apparition at his grandparents house on the north side of Chicago. Over the past 20-plus years, Rick has been on dozens of investigations with large paranormal groups to being completely independent. Rick began writing for Paranormal Underground magazine in May 2009, and a year later he became cohost of Paranormal Underground Radio. Rick is the American Correspondent for The European Paranormal Activity Society. He is also a senior Chicago guide for Para Adventures, leading tourists through Chicago's most famous haunted hotspots.
